  22. #pragma once
  23. #include "Sample.h"
  24. namespace Urho3D
  25. {
  26. class Window;
  27. }
  28. /// A simple 'HelloWorld' GUI created purely from code.
  29. /// This sample demonstrates:
  30. /// - Creation of controls and building a UI hierarchy
  31. /// - Loading UI style from XML and applying it to controls
  32. /// - Handling of global and per-control events
  33. /// For more advanced users (beginners can skip this section):
  34. /// - Dragging UIElements
  35. /// - Displaying tooltips
  36. /// - Accessing available Events data (eventData)
  37. class HelloGUI : public Sample
  38. {
  39. OBJECT(HelloGUI);
  40. public:
  41. /// Construct.
  42. HelloGUI(Context* context);
  43. /// Setup after engine initialization and before running the main loop.
  44. virtual void Start();
  45. private:
  46. /// Create and initialize a Window control.
  47. void InitWindow();
  48. /// Create and add various common controls for demonstration purposes.
  49. void InitControls();
  50. /// Subscribe to UI events.
  51. void SubscribeToEvents();
  52. /// Handle any UI control being clicked.
  53. void HandleControlClicked(StringHash eventType, VariantMap& eventData);
  54. /// Handle close button pressed and released.
  55. void HandleClosePressed(StringHash eventType, VariantMap& eventData);
  56. /// Create a draggable fish button
  57. void CreateDraggableFish();
  58. /// Handle drag begin
  59. void HandleDragBegin(StringHash eventType, VariantMap& eventData);
  60. /// Handle drag move
  61. void HandleDragMove(StringHash eventType, VariantMap& eventData);
  62. /// Handle drag end
  63. void HandleDragEnd(StringHash eventType, VariantMap& eventData);
  64. /// The Window.
  65. SharedPtr<Window> window_;
  66. /// The UI's root UIElement.
  67. SharedPtr<UIElement> uiRoot_;
  68. };
